Transaction 12906a47447268c2b5e31a255ebdc2f108fcfd30d7f59caba6240ad7904c362f
1 Input
1 Output
-
12906a47447268c2b5e31a255ebdc2f108fcfd30d7f59caba6240ad7904c362f:0
- value
- 33688
- script pubkey
- OP_0 OP_PUSHBYTES_20 de2f6184e8418ef8e0a5d201149ad65d15aae744
- address
- bc1qmchkrp8ggx803c996gq3fxkkt5264e6y6349zm